Buccaneers
Set in the vibrant Poblacion district of Makati, Buccaneers Rum & Kitchen is a well-known pirate-themed bar recognised for its impressive rum selection, inventive cocktails, and lively, celebratory atmosphere. Consistently ranked among Asia’s best bars, it offers an immersive experience at 5668 Don Pedro.
